Was driving back to our campground last night an we began to here a "clacking" sound coming from our motor. So we limped it back. Our motor is a freshly built 1776cc with less than 300 miles on it. Figuring I need to adjust the valves, I let it sit over night. This morning, when I pulled the valve cover, I found that the elephants foot on #1 intake had sheared off and was lying in the valve cover! Most brands of swivel foot adjusters are not worth as much as their packaging is. Check a place like Pelican Parts for real Porsche adjusters.

If need be you can clean up your valve stem with a Dremel, having wrapped very thing in the rocker box with oily rags first.
